I've tried basically all the free art programs on appstore, nothing caught my attention enough to keep. What I found a little while ago is realVNC. You get the app on your ipad and install a program on your pc (VNCserver), this lets you see and control your pc desktop on your ipad. Using this setup, I can tinker with my main toolset from anywhere.
The only downside is your cursor movement is controlled with dragging on the touch screen rather than snapping to where you touch, so it's not possible to paint directly. That being said, it's still adequate enough to push some pixels around on the go!
